COVID Halloween? One pediatrician mom shares her recommendations to make this holiday spooky and safe.

Is it safe to celebrate Halloween in the COVID-19 pandemic? 
Last weekend, Centers for Disease Control and Prevention director Rochelle Walensky said she is hopeful for Halloween 2021 when it comes to trick-or-treating. “I wouldn’t necessarily go to a crowded Halloween party, but I think that we should be able to let our kids go trick-or-treating in small groups,” Walensky said on CBS’ 'Face the Nation.' “I hope that we can do that this year.”
